   For those of you who never use open source or OSX OSes wine emulates direct X (among other things) to make Windows games installable and playable on non windows OSes (particularly UNIX based OSes like OSX and all Linux builds).  It currently works with some games like Guild Wars, Lord of the Rings Online, Half life 2, World of Warcraft and others; ideally in the future it will work quickly with current games.  On that day I will no longer install Vista/XP on my mac laptops or built computers and will be the better for it.
